I know ESR has a decent archive but since the loss of Challenge-TV does anyone know of any other archives online that you might be able to find some classic matches?

I'm mainly looking for CPMA duel matches from the early 2000s.

I'd love to watch the CPM15 match here: https://www.plusforward.net/cpma/post/39108/Apheleon-vs-rat/